Bonanza’s Sterling Sprau and Desean Martin are fairly proficient when it comes to moving the football.
They proved it again Friday night in Bonanza’s 53-34 victory against Clark. Sprau, the quarterback, went 13-for-17 passing for 294 yards and five touchdowns.
Martin caught two of those touchdown passes and combined them with two rushing scores. Overall, Martin had nearly 300 all-purpose yards.
Clark’s only offense came from running back Andre Clay, who had 171 yards and three touchdowns.
